Lessons from Building an Online Toolkit to Aid Open-Source Investigations

Publicly available sources can be a tool for all journalists

Affiliate and former fellow Johanna Wild details her efforts (undertaken during her fellowship term) to make it simpler for journalists to find and use open-source research tools. She built Bellingcat's Online Investigation Toolkit to organize online tools including ones for satellite imagery, social media, and archiving. She shares four key lessons she learned in building the Toolkit with Nieman. "While many providers use marketing language to present their tools in a solely positive light, we made sure to identify a tool’s potential weaknesses and limitations in addition to its usefulness."
